The summer season is officially here, and it’s time to transform our closets for the occasion. Gone are the days of springy pastels and floor-length trousers—replaced with flowing dresses and beach hats. But there’s more to summer fashion than simple beachwear and shorts, and knowing additional trends can really take your style to the next level. Here are some of the most noteworthy women’s summer fashion trends for 2020 and how to incorporate them into your look.

Colorful Leather

While wearing leather is a fashion trend that most people associate with the winter months, it’s interesting to note that it can also make a statement in other seasons. In fact, colorful leather is growing in popularity for the summer as it provides the class and elegance of leather clothing with the bright colors associated with the summer. This material is now available in a multitude of stylish colors, from dark green and cream to bright pastel pinks and yellows. Just be sure you choose a cooler day to break out these garments and stay out of direct sunlight to keep from damaging them.

Mixed and Matched Prints

Another important women’s summer fashion trend for 2020 is the appeal of mixed and matched outfit patterns. This trend isn’t as much about overwhelming patterns as it is about finding a balance between several colors and designs. It’s a great way to liven up a dull wardrobe and create a unique look that’s all your own. So, while it might take a few tips and tricks to perfect, this fashion trend is well worth having in your summer arsenal. As an additional note, retro prints are making a comeback and make the perfect base pattern to pair with another.

Side Cutouts and Cold Shoulders

The cold shoulder look has been a trend for several years now, and it will always go down as a fashion staple. But now, there’s a new trend that extenuates the appeal of cold shoulder outfits and provides an extra touch of intrigue—the side cutout. Whether it’s a tasteful slit or some playful ribbons showing a bit of bare skin along the side of a dress, this style screams summer fun. You can even class up this design with an overlay of lace or thin fabric.
